Proban Fabric: A Technical Overview

Wiki Article

Proban fabric, the increasingly popular material, represents a specialized finish applied to various textiles, typically blends of materials. It’s neither inherently this new variety of fiber itself, but rather a proprietary process created to impart exceptional flame resistance or moisture management capabilities. The core method involves depositing a special chemical compound, often incorporating phosphorus-based components, swiftly onto the surface of the fabric. This creates the durable barrier that interrupts a combustion process and prevents a fabric from readily igniting. Distinct from simply coating the fabric, Proban’s penetration results in a more long-lasting and integrated flame retardancy which withstands numerous washes and continuous use.

Delving Into Proban's Fire Defense System

Proban's exceptional fire defense isn't simply a treatment; it’s a sophisticated scientific procedure rooted in polymer chemistry. Initially, a unique polymer, often a altered acrylic or polyurethane, is administered onto the fabric. This polymer isn't inherently heat resistant; the magic happens in the subsequent linking phase. Using a reactive compound, typically a phosphorus-containing substance, the polymer chains are bound in a three-dimensional network. This intricate network significantly reduces the fabric's tendency to burn. Furthermore, specific Proban formulations can also promote char formation, creating an insulating layer that more limits website heat spread. The result is a long-lasting heat protection that meets demanding industrial regulations.
